Tunable dual wavelength Q-switched fiber laser for DIAL applications

Abstract

We demonstrate stable dual wavelength Q-switched fiber laser for applications in Differential Absorptions Lidar (DIAL). The advantages of tunable wavelengths and high stability in an efficient, rugged, compact and light system make it a promising technology for LIDAR systems.
